Letter to Mr. Frank J. Gaffney, Jr., Center for Security Policy

Letter

Dear Mr. Gaffney:

My office received your October 29, 2010 letter regarding the Council on American-Islamic Relations. I found this letter to be yet another example of the Center for Security Policy's (CSP) xenophobic, anti-Muslim, and hate-based tactics for which your organization is so well known.

CSP has earned a reputation for being radical in philosophy and extremist in practice, which I find dangerous to both the citizens of the United States and our Constitution. CSP's work appears to be little more than well-funded propaganda disguised as scholarly discourse.

I am proud of my work with Minnesota's Muslim community and with Muslim-Americans throughout the United States. It is my intention to continue to work to ensure that religious freedom and economic opportunity for Muslim-Americans and people of all faiths are protected from intolerance, bigotry, and extremism.

Sincerely,
Betty McCollum
